Output 515e5b7be07260f85e7710bbc0fd304a58754fa0493ad71907784f5194371038:1

value
3007911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b7bf642286c69220c26ec764b52401ecd7188f6 OP_EQUAL
address
3LEwbWfyW4BHX3bKts7xaKzeF2hvPJN28H
transaction
515e5b7be07260f85e7710bbc0fd304a58754fa0493ad71907784f5194371038
confirmations
337152
spent
true